Job description

Job Overview

Position: Level 3 Teaching Assistant at Southall School. Hours: 32.5 hours per week, term time plus PD days. Permanent.

Responsibilities

The job involves working across the whole school and with individual students. It is desirable for the Teaching Assistant to have experience of working with children with SEN and complex needs.

Qualifications and Experience
  • Level two numeracy/literacy skills.
  • NVQ 3 for Teaching Assistants or equivalent qualification or experience.
  • An understanding of Child Protection policies.
  • Patience and empathy towards pupils.
  • Good command of literacy and numeracy.
Salary and Hours

Hours: 32.5 per week. Salary: £13.90 per hour (including market factor), paid at scale 3.

Closing Date

The closing date for this post is Wednesday 9th September at 9 am.

Safeguarding and HR Requirements

Southall School is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people and expects all staff to share this commitment. The post will be offered subject to the satisfactory return of safeguarding checks, two references and online checks. Candidates will be subject to a Google check.
